About the Theme - Addressing Crime & Violence: Strengthening Communities for the Health, Safety & Wellness of Louisiana Families

Louisiana has a long history of collective trauma, which has influenced past and present generations and will continue to impact future generations until that trauma is acknowledged and addressed. Healthy Blue Louisiana and the Louisiana Public Health Institute are committed to addressing the health and racial inequities that continue to affect the social well-being, health, and health outcomes of our communities throughout Louisiana. The symposium will highlight the importance of elevating community voices in developing equitable solutions to addressing crime and violence in Louisiana.
